<!--pages/message/message.wxml-->
|
<view class="container">
|
<!-- 加载状态 -->
|
<view wx:if="{{loading}}" class="loading-container">
|
<view class="loading-spinner"></view>
|
<text class="loading-text">加载中...</text>
|
</view>
|
|
<!-- 消息内容 -->
|
<view wx:else class="message-content">
|
<!-- 消息统计 -->
|
<view class="message-stats">
|
<text class="stats-text">共 {{messages.length}} 条消息</text>
|
</view>
|
|
<!-- 消息列表 -->
|
<view class="message-list">
|
<!-- 空状态 -->
|
<view wx:if="{{messages.length === 0}}" class="empty-state">
|
<text class="empty-icon">📭</text>
|
<text class="empty-text">暂无消息</text>
|
</view>
|
|
<!-- 消息项 -->
|
<view
|
wx:for="{{messages}}"
|
wx:key="id"
|
class="message-item"
|
>
|
<view class="message-content-text">{{item.content}}</view>
|
<view class="message-time">{{item.formattedTime}}</view>
|
</view>
|
</view>
|
</view>
|
</view>
|